This has been my handle history with my miyata CF base...
Reeder...good handle but [censored] for flatland because it hurts when it
hits me.
Kinport #1...body varial down from stand up ww, I clipped the handle on
the way down. snap.
KH handle... had to bend a lot to fit on the base so it flexed a lot
and got smashed down easily.
Kinport# 2...I got a brand new kinport and I was trying a Xavier style
flatland trick that involved putting a lot of weight on the front of
the seat and it bent down and kind of got pushed out on the bottom part
where my old one snapped and it started to flex.
So I kind of ran out of handle options so I decided to try to reinforce
my kinport so it can't bend anymore in that one spot where my first one
snapped. I drillled it and put 2 bolts through it near the bottom in a
good place where it won't mess up how the handle fits on the base and
it won't poke my fingers from the inside.
